8 years ago, I had a nose tip surgery using septal cartilage without an implant, but translucency developed at the tip of my nose and my left columella started protruding, so I began going around for consultations.
I went to two places today, so I’ll first leave Part 1 of my consultation review. Both places are in Busan.
1. ㅇ Clinic I went because I had an appointment at 10:30 in the morning, but there were a lot of people.
After taking a CT scan, before consulting with the director, I first had a consultation with the consultant. She explained, “It would be good to do this,” and “This can also be done,” so I thought she was the one performing the surgery... She was kind, but it was also a bit flustering.
I was supposed to consult with the director, but I waited for about an hour. The desk staff basically ignored me, but the two consultants were restless because I was waiting so long, so thanks to them I felt a bit less upset (I’m pretty simple-minded...ㅠㅠ)
During the consultation with the director, he said that if the nose tip is shaved down slightly and covered with dermis from behind the ear, the translucency would likely disappear. He said that if a new support column is made, the columella may look crooked (he said my current columella is straight too, and it looks that way because my face is naturally asymmetrical). He explained that the dermis would be harvested through a 2 cm incision behind the ear, and since some shaving would be needed, the nose tip would become slightly lower than now. He also said the surgery time would be about 1 hour. But he said it seemed like I didn’t necessarily need to do it.
When discussing the cost with the consultant, she said it was originally 4.07 million won, but if I partially disclose the surgery, with the consultant discount included, it could go down to 3.5 million won. Aftercare is provided for up to 3 years. They have CCTV, and a guardian can watch in real time. I can choose between sedation anesthesia and local anesthesia. The deposit is 10% of the surgery fee. The consultation fee is 10,000 won, taken when making the reservation to prevent no-shows, but it is refunded after the consultation. There is no CT fee.
2. ㅁ Clinic I waited less than 10 minutes and went straight into the consultation with the director. After looking at my nose, he said, “Why do you want to do it? At this level, you don’t need to. No more problems will occur, and if you have revision surgery, the result won’t be very different compared to the effort involved,” and told me to just leave it as it is. The director was so confident that for a moment I wondered if it was actually okay and whether I really didn’t need to do it. The consultation with the director was over in 5 minutes. No consultation fee.
